Job Description
We are looking to hire a mid-level Analytics Engineer in Berlin who will design, develop, and maintain robust and scalable data pipelines for analytics and reporting purposes.
Main Tasks
- Implement ETL processes to extract, transform, and load data from diverse sources into our data warehouse.
- Optimize data models and structures to support efficient and high-performance analytics.
- Collaborate with data scientists, business analysts, and other stakeholders to understand analytics requirements and translate them into technical solutions.
- Develop and implement analytical solutions and algorithms to derive actionable insights from large datasets.
- Contribute to the design and implementation of advanced analytics models and statistical analyses.
- Stay up to date on industry best practices and emerging technologies in analytics and data engineering.
- Drive the adoption of best practices in data engineering processes, coding standards, and documentation.
- Collaborate with data architects to design and optimize data architectures that align with business goals.
- Ensure the integrity, security, and performance of data solutions through thorough testing and optimization.
- Contribute to the development and maintenance of data dictionaries, schemas, and documentation.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ure alignment between technical solutions and business objectives.
- Communicate complex technical concepts and insights to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
- Participate in knowledge-sharing activities within the analytics team and the broader organization.
Qualifications
Education
-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science, Data Science, Statistics, or a proven experience in related fields.
Experience
- 2+ years of relevant work experience in analytics, data engineering, or a related field.
- Experience with real-world projects that involve handling and analyzing substantial datasets.
Technical Skills
- Proficiency in programming languages commonly used in analytics, such as SQL, Python, R, Java or similar.
- Knowledge of data manipulation, transformation, modeling, orchestration and analysis tools, such as dBT, Pandas, NumPy, Spark, Airflow or similar.
- Experience with data visualization tools like Looker, Tableau, or Power BI.
- Familiarity with database systems and querying languages (e.g., Redshift, Big Query).
- Understanding of data modeling concepts and experience with data warehousing solutions.
- Knowledge of ETL (Extract, Transform, Load) processes and tools.
- Ability to analyze and interpret complex data sets to extract meaningful insights.
- Problem-solving skills with a focus on practical and actionable solutions.
- Ability to work collaboratively with cross-functional teams, including data scientists, business analysts, and software engineers.
- Effective communication skills to convey techn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ders.
- Experience in managing and prioritizing multiple tasks or projects.
- Ability to work within timelines and deliver results efficiently.
